Durability and Long-Term Benefits
Durability also forms a basis of difference while choosing a wood filler, especially if they are to be used outside. Products such as Dura-Fix are specially formulated to accommodate the natural expansion and contraction of wood due to changing conditions. The flexibility of this type of fillers will rise with the general movement of the wood, hence preventing cracks and subsequent damage. The flexible wood fillers have a permanent bond that lasts for decades, in distinction with rigid repair materials whose bond might fail with time.
